Prenatal Genetic Testing on TikTok: Lay Narratives and Expertise
Robin Jensen1, Emma Murdock1, Naomi Riches2
1Department of Communication, University of Utah.
Abstract:
In recent years, social-media platforms have seen a rise in content related to pregnancy "gender reveals," wherein parents-to-be draw from the results of NIPT (noninvasive prenatal testing) to disclose the "gender" of their fetus. Such reveals are grounded in inaccurate understandings of NIPT as a technology and its relationship to fetal sex or gender information, understandings that can perpetuate harms for parents-to-be and infants alike. To explore where these understandings come from and how they are communicated, this study offers a thematic, narrative analysis of 40 recent TikTok videos posted by lay individuals discussing both NIPT and fetal sex chromosomes, sex, and/or gender. Findings reveal that almost all videos upheld both a diagnostic myth about NIPT (that the test is diagnostic rather than a probabilistic screening) and a conflation myth (wherein sex and gender are considered equivalent concepts). Videos fell into one of three narrative themes (i.e., personal storytelling; educational framing; co-storytelling), which were made persuasive by specific configurations of lay expertise (i.e., experiential; hybrid; relational, respectively). These results extend predominant theories of lay expertise by identifying and operationalizing distinct forms of lay expertise at work in the context of health communication on social media.
